1. The Mechanics of Speed in Casino Games

Speed in casino games is not just about how quickly the game itself runs; it also pertains to how quickly players can make decisions and interact with the game. This speed can come in many forms:

  • Game Pace: Some casino games naturally lend themselves to fast-paced play. For example, games like roulette, blackjack, and baccarat have relatively short rounds, allowing players to complete multiple sessions in a short time. Speeding up the game round without sacrificing quality allows players to maximize their enjoyment and potential winnings.
  • Betting Process: In many online casinos, players can adjust the speed of their betting. For instance, some platforms have features that allow players to place multiple bets with a single click, reducing the time spent between rounds. This allows more action to unfold in a shorter amount of time, keeping players engaged and involved in the gameplay.
  • Results Generation: In traditional land-based casinos, results take time due to the manual process involved in shuffling cards or spinning wheels. However, in online casinos, the use of Random Number Generators (RNGs) has allowed for almost instantaneous results, enhancing the speed of games and the flow of gameplay. RNGs also contribute to fairness by ensuring that results are unpredictable and unbiased.

2. The Role of Technology in Speed Enhancement

The role of technology in speeding up casino games is paramount. With the use of high-speed internet connections, powerful servers, and cutting-edge software, casinos can enhance the overall gameplay experience for their players.

  • Real-Time Streaming and Interactive Gaming: In live casino games, real-time streaming allows players to engage in games with live dealers, while maintaining the fast pace typical of online gambling. The interaction between players and dealers can be instantaneous, ensuring that the gameplay flow is smooth. Streaming technology has evolved so much that players often feel like they are in a real casino, with the added benefit of faster gameplay.
  • Automated Systems and AI: Modern casinos use art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ning algorithms to monitor and optimize game speeds. AI is utilized to predict player behavior and adjust game mechanics accordingly, enabling a more fluid gaming experience. For example, AI can automatically shuffle cards, deal them quickly, or make payouts faster, improving the overall speed of the game without human intervention.
  • Instant Play Features: Online casinos increasingly offer “instant play” versions of their games, which are optimized to load quickly, allowing players to start playing with minimal delay. The use of HTML5 technology in game design allows seamless integration of games into browsers without the need for downloads or long wait times. This instant access ensures that players can dive straight into the action, reducing any friction in the experience.
